We are looking for a Project Manager to join our Petrochemicals team in Port Arthur, TX.

Come create chemistry with us!

BASF’s Petrochemical division is the starting point of BASF's petrochemical value creation worldwide, also known as “the heart of the Verbund,” representing the world's largest chemical markets. Together, let us keep the heart beating one creative solution at a time!

We are seeking a professional like you to be responsible for the management of capital projects within the operating units at the Port Arthur site. As a Project Manager you will provide the project team managerial and technical leadership to develop and execute capital projects using the BASF phase gated process. You will work closely with team members from the site and business organizations to ensure the safe and effective implementation of capital projects while ensuring the project objectives and stakeholder expectations are met.

As a Project Manager, you create chemistry by...
  • Developing project scopes, generating cost estimates, and preparing project objective memos to obtain funding authorizations.
  • Ensuring compliance with environmental, safety and health requirements and promoting a safe work environment.
  • Requesting and coordinating necessary resources for engineering design, deliverables, and procurement.
  • Developing and maintaining partnerships with project manufacturing representatives.
  • Adhering to equipment/materials specifications in bid evaluations and procurement activities.
  • Maintaining project data, monitoring progress, performing status reporting, and spending control.
  • Monitoring and supporting construction activities to ensure projects are completed according to design deliverables and quality standards.
  • Ensuring successful project start up and completion of project-related action items.
  • Closing projects per guidelines and ensuring proper documentation is completed.
  • Participating and contributing to project management procedures, guidelines, standards, and practices.
  • Mentoring and coaching less experienced engineers.
If you have...
  • A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(chemical or mechanical preferred) and at least 5 years of project management experience in a petrochemical plant or refinery.
  • Strong personal commitment to safety and personal accountability.
  • Strong interpersonal, communication, administrative and personal motivation skills to lead multi-discipline project teams.
  • Experience managing projects with a Total Installed Cost (TIC) greater than $2MM using a phase gate project methodology.
  • Working knowledge of chemical process equipment and industry design codes and practices.
  • Willingness to continoustly learn and stay updated with industry trends and best practices.
